Abstract

The utility model relates to a reinforced mixing device, including chassis, the agitator tank body, (mixing) shaft, stirring vane I, drive mechanism, motor and stirring vane II, being provided with on the chassis and rotating the track groove, agitator tank body bottom is provided with and rotates track groove assorted arc changes the board, and the agitator tank body changes the integrated circuit board through the arc and establishes the rotation track inslot on the chassis, the (mixing) shaft sets up internally at the agitator tank, and the lower part of (mixing) shaft is provided with the stirring vane I of a plurality of slopes along the axial, and upper portion is passed through drive mechanism and is connected with motor drive, the stirring vane II that the axial was provided with a plurality of slopes follows on the internal wall of agitator tank, and stirring vane I and II crisscross settings of stirring vane. The utility model discloses a reinforced mixing device enables the more even of mortar stirring, improves stirring efficiency, reduces construction cost.

Description

A kind of strengthening mixing arrangement
Technical field
This utility model relates to building machinery technical field, is specifically related to a kind of strengthening mixing arrangement.
Background technology
At present in constructions work is constructed, many Plant fiber have been applied to building materials field.But owing to adding substantial amounts of fiber substance in this building material so that common mixing arrangement is difficult to be mixed uniformly, and stirs and uneven can produce a large amount of mortar precipitation.
It is uneven that mixing arrangement for stirring mortar of the prior art stirs the mortar blended, and mortar is with good adherence of on stirring vane, and mortar stirring efficiency is low, causes that construction cost increases.
Utility model content
The purpose of this utility model is to provide a kind of strengthening mixing arrangement, can make the more uniform of mortar stirring mixing, improve stirring efficiency, reduce construction cost.
In order to solve above-mentioned technical problem, this utility model be the technical scheme is that a kind of strengthening mixing arrangement, including chassis, stirring tank body, shaft, stirring vane I, drive mechanism, motor and stirring vane II, described chassis is provided with rotation track groove, stirring tank base is provided with the arc flap matched with rotation track groove, stirring tank body is fastened in the rotation track groove on chassis by arc flap, described shaft is arranged in agitator tank body, the axially disposed stirring vane I having multiple inclination in the bottom of shaft, top is connected with motor-driven by drive mechanism, the axially disposed stirring vane II having multiple inclination in described stirring inner tank wall, and stirring vane I and stirring vane II are crisscross arranged.
Described stirring vane I and stirring vane II are both provided with prevent mortar to be trapped in guiding gutter thereon.
Described stirring vane I is arranged diagonally downward.
Described stirring vane II tilts upward setting.
Compared with prior art, this utility model has the advantages that this utility model one strengthening mixing arrangement, by arranging stirring vane on stirring tank body, and make stirring tank body and shaft rotate round about simultaneously, the more uniform of mortar stirring mixing can be made, stirring vane is provided with guiding gutter, effectively prevents mortar to be bonded on stirring vane, improve stirring efficiency, reduce construction cost.

Detailed description of the invention
Below in conjunction with the drawings and specific embodiments, this utility model being elaborated, the present embodiment, premised on technical solutions of the utility model, gives detailed embodiment and concrete operating process, but protection domain of the present utility model is not limited to following embodiment.
nullAs shown in the figure,A kind of strengthening mixing arrangement,Including chassis 1、Stirring tank body 2、Shaft 3、Stirring vane I 4、Drive mechanism 5、Motor 6 and stirring vane II 7,Described chassis 1 is provided with rotation track groove 101,It is provided with, bottom stirring tank body 2, the arc flap 201 matched with rotation track groove 101,Stirring tank body 2 is fastened in the rotation track groove 101 on chassis 1 by arc flap 201,Described shaft 3 is arranged in stirring tank body 2,The axially disposed stirring vane I 4 having multiple inclination in the bottom of shaft 3,Top is in transmission connection by drive mechanism 5 and motor 6,The axially disposed stirring vane II 7 having multiple inclination on described stirring tank body 2 inwall,Described stirring vane II 7 tilts upward setting,Described stirring vane I 4 is arranged diagonally downward,And stirring vane I 4 and stirring vane II 7 are crisscross arranged.
Described stirring vane I 4 and stirring vane II 7 are both provided with prevent mortar to be trapped in guiding gutter 8 thereon, effectively prevent mortar to be bonded on stirring vane I 4 and stirring vane II 7.
The stirring tank body 2 of strengthening mixing arrangement described in the utility model rotates along rotation track groove 101 and contrary with the rotation direction of shaft 3, can make the more uniform of mortar stirring mixing, substantially increase the stirring efficiency of mortar, reduce construction cost.
